Temme Memorial Races - Dunton
Mon
24th March
Easter Monday saw the
VC Revolution riders travel to Dunton to race on the
Ford Test Track, the Bill Temme Memorial Races we
promoted by local club Glendene, first thing the weather
was looking better than the previous days blizzards but
that was short lived and the snow soon returned to
hamper some of the racing. Fraser Woods had a good ride
in the Youth event to finish in sixth place.

In the 3 / 4 Category
Senior event there were several VCR riders who were all
active during the race, Andrew Elderfield, Brett
Travers, Tom Starmer and Dick Woods all finished in the
peleton after being very active during the race and
Richard Norris had a great ride in the second race of
his comeback season by taking the bunch sprint and
fourth place overall.

In the afternoons
Elite senior race VCR’s Joe Skipper had a fantastic
ride, the race was very active early on with numerous
attacks, eventually a group of 7 managed to break away
and Joe held on to take second place overall from
eventual race winner Adam Norris [Heron Cyclesport]. Joe
has put some recent bad luck behind him and is looking
forward to this weekends Tour of the Dengie Marshes
which fields a line up of some of the best riders in the
